Leadership Philosophy Statement
Leadership is something tangible that cannot be taken lightly. Leaders recognize the uniqueness of the team around them and strive to utilize the differences between each member to form a cohesive unit.
Humility will be the forefront and focus of my leadership philosophy. I want to foster an environment where my team feels safe to voice concerns that may reflect poorly on the department. I want my team to feel comfortable approaching me with ideas and questions that can help improve the department.
The ability to evolve is key to being an effective leader. A leader needs to be their own worst critic in order to better themselves and evolve. As a team we can evolve and achieve success.
